Psychiatrists have long theorized that people like to scare themselves for many reasons. Here's some of the main ones:

  • The adrenaline rush you get from activating your "Fight or Flight" response.
  • We get to explore horror and horror able things from a safe distance( unless you enjoy personally going to legit haunted places or walking around the hood, carrying a big sign that says "I Hate *Iggers!" Than your just plain nuts)
  • The bonding process that happens when a group of people mutually experience a scary or traumatic event. This causes an instant feeling camaraderie with the persons that were with you when such and such happened.
  • It's just an irresistible draw for most of us. It's a thrill, a morbid curiosity that I definitely identify with.
  • Not only can boost your confidence levels( it can when you face your fears) but it can also be a turn on, as in in some cases fear=sexual arousal.
